MPD newsletter 9/4/15 MPD HiCom
The following will be a list of items, explanation, rules, and expectations we have in MPD. Most of you know alot of these, but this will clear up a lot of questions/confusions in the department.
1. Bank 2. Patrolling 3. Cadets 4. Discipline/Rules 5. Trainings/Promotions 6. Tryouts
Bank As most of you know the bank is a hotspot for crime, and every agency hangs out at the bank. As of 9/4/15 NO camping should be done at the bank. This includes, but is not limited to; -Standing in, and around the bank -Parking at, or near the bank -Socializing (anywhere, you have a job to do, do it) -Entering the parking garage to watch the bank -Getting on nearby buildings to watch the bank.
The only exceptions that would allow you to camp at the bank, and anywhere really is if one of the following were occurring; -Backup requested -Robbery, and/or other crime -While patrolling (Meaning you are in your car, driving around) -A HR is with you at the time -Known threats are at/near the bank
Reasons for this rule are very self explanatory. Below include, but again is not limited to; -There is a whole LV/DC to patrol (Crime happens everywhere) -The bank is a distraction. You are more prone to socialize, then work -You’re not doing your job if your at the bank. Join BoA if you want to protect it.
Any violation of the rule can result in punishment.
Patrolling
The definition of patrol is; keep watch over (an area) by regularly walking or traveling around or through it. In MPD we have a primary task as law enforcement to keep the streets on which we are patrolling safe, and secure. In order to do this you must travel throughout the ENTIRE city, instead of camping at one place each time. This not only adds realism, but allows you to do your job more efficiently. In DC, and LV there are several different hotspots, most of which are spread out. These include; -Bank (DC/LV) -Lockpicks (LV) -VS (DC/LV0 -White house (DC) -BBB (LV) -Gun dealers (LV/DC) -Houses (LV0 Those are just some of the well known hotspots you should try to travel through along your patrol route. You are not suppose to camp, stay, nor watch any area for long periods of time, but instead try going through each looking for crime to occur. Any help, or questions you have regarding how you should patrol can be sent to any HR at any time.
